The video discusses South Korea's economic focus on semiconductors and petrochemicals, highlighting the risks of a narrow export base and the impact of US tariffs. It then shifts to China's PMI data, examining whether the numbers indicate economic expansion or contraction. The discussion concludes with an analysis of China's policy stimulus efforts, including tax cuts and infrastructure spending, to maintain economic balance despite trade challenges.
